Summary: This is a unique opportunity to join the AEi team as a Senior Electrical Engineer contributing to the design and implementation of electrical controls and electronic systems for the capital equipment used in the manufacture of camera module assemblies for the automotive (ADAS systems), mobile, consumer, computational, gesture recognition, stereoscopic, 3-D, wearable, security and medical camera markets. As a senior electrical engineer, you will work with other electrical and systems engineers, marketing and applications engineering to translate market and customer specific requirements into product architecture, design concepts and solutions that meet timeline and cost targets. Technical challenges range from system integration and machine automation to design and verification of high-speed digital signal transmission lines to the development of complex test fixtures and custom PCBs. You will work with cross functional teams in engineering and operations to develop solutions from concept to complete production, including analysis and validation. You will create test plans and execute data collection on contact resistance, leakage, inductance, bandwidth, crosstalk and rise time of interface solutions and design test fixtures and printed circuit boards to test the interface structures. About AEi Automation Engineering Incorporated, (AEi), is a Mycronic company, and the global technical leader in Active Alignment camera module assembly and test systems (CMAT) and photonics module alignment and test machines (PMAT) to the automotive, mobile, consumer, computational, gesture recognition, stereoscopic, 3-D, wearable, security and medical camera markets. AEi’s modular platform machines execute precision multi-axis active optical alignment based on a portfolio of patented and patent- pending technologies which enable the production, assembly and test of camera modules with the highest image quality available while optimizing throughput and yield for maximum performance. For more than 27 years AEi has provided engineering expertise, exceptional products and reliable service that help its customers turn innovative ideas into competitive advantage. AEi has operations in the U.S., Europe and Asia. The company is headquartered in Wilmington, MA. Salary and benefits will be competitive and commensurate with experience for all locations.
